FIGURE 57. Tharyx moniliformis n. sp. A–B, SEM of posterior neuropodial acicular hooks; C–D, two sexually mature adults, photographed alive; E, anterior end, dorsal view; F, posterior brooding segments, lateral view; G–H, detail of brooding segments with eggs and embryos. Arrows point eggs, embryos, or brooding segments. A–B, ANDEEP Sta. PS/61, 139-10 (SMF 24951); C–D Sta. PS/61 133-6 (SMF 24950); E–H, holotype (LACM-AHF Poly 10229).
